AS A FRESHMAN (2006-07)
Positioned at the No. 5 and No. 6 spots in the singles lineup … posted an overall singles record of 3-15 … defeated Rhode Island’s James McGuire 6-2, 6-3 (4/1) … played with three different doubles partners … tallied an overall doubles record of 4-15 … went 2-1 in the ACC with teammate Soma Kesthely at the No. 3 position … the pair defeated Georgia Tech’s Roebuck/Gvelesiani, 8-4 (4/15).
BEFORE BC
All-B1-City Player of the Year as a junior and senior … earned All-B1-City Team honors as a freshman and sophomore … four-year captain of high school team … only lost three matches in four seasons … earned the Brian Vahaly award for community service.
PERSONAL
Enrolled in the School of Arts and Sciences … Brian is the youngest of Bruce and Janice Garber’s three children … father played hockey for Providence College for four years and coached professional hockey for eight years … born September 9, 1988.
